Tractor Supply Management

Management criteria checks 2/4

Tractor Supply's CEO is Hal Lawton, appointed in Jan 2020, has a tenure of 6.58 years. total yearly compensation is $32.28M, comprised of 4.2% salary and 95.8% bonuses, including company stock and options. directly owns 0.058% of the company’s shares, worth $10.25M. The average tenure of the management team and the board of directors is 6.3 years and 7.5 years respectively.

Tractor Supply: Low Valuation, Self-Help Initiatives, And Temporary Headwinds Create An Opportunity

Summary Tractor Supply Company is rated a 'Buy,' with the current valuation reflecting excessive pessimism about temporary macro headwinds impacting discretionary sales. TSCO's resilient C.U.E. category, comprising 40-45% of revenue, continues to show positive demand despite broader sales pressure from high fuel costs and weak sentiment. Self-help initiatives—Project Fusion, localization, and Final Mile delivery—are expected to drive comp sales and earnings growth from FY27, aided by easier comps. The stock trades at a discount to historical averages, offers a ~3% dividend yield, and is positioned for 9-10% total returns as earnings recover. Read the full article on Seeking Alpha

What’s in the News Tractor Supply and Instacart launched a nationwide same day delivery partnership across more than 2,400 stores, giving customers access to pet food, livestock feed, farm and ranch supplies, garden products, tools, and hardware through the Instacart app and website, with stated delivery times as fast as one hour and no markups.

What’s in the News for Tractor Supply Tractor Supply completed the acquisition of VIP Petcare, a mobile veterinary services provider with community clinics in about 2,700 retail locations across 39 states, including roughly 1,700 Tractor Supply stores, aiming to expand convenient pet healthcare access and integrate services with its Allivet pharmacy platform.

What's in the News Tractor Supply reaffirmed its earnings guidance for fiscal 2026, with net sales growth expected in a 4% to 6% range, comparable store sales in a 1% to 3% range, an operating margin rate of 9.3% to 9.6%, net income of US$1.11b to US$1.17b, and earnings per diluted share of US$2.13 to US$2.23 (company guidance).

Compensation vs Market: Hal's total compensation ($USD32.28M) is above average for companies of similar size in the US market ($USD14.56M).

Compensation vs Earnings: Hal's compensation has increased by more than 20% whilst company earnings have fallen more than 20% in the past year.
